Extracted from The Redlands Daily Facts (Redlands, CA)
Saturday, January 2, 1965

William C. Lash dies; 44-year local resident

Funeral services will be held Saturday, Jan. 9, for William C. Lash, a resident of Redlands for the past 44 years, who died on Dec. 26 [sic 31]. He was 80.

Mr. Lash, a native of Kendelville [sic Kendallville], Indiana, had resided at the family home on Nevada street since 1931. His wife was the late Edna Mary Lash.

After coming to Redlands, Mr. Lash became foreman of the W. H. James Ranch, where he was employed for a number of years. The ranch later became the Stitt Ranch.

He was a member of Redlands Lodge No. 300, F. and A.M., the Royal Arch, Knights Templar and Copa Del Oro Chapter No. 142, OES.

Surviving are two sons, James M. Lash of Niland and Carroll C. Lash of Northridge; one daughter, Mrs. Monte (Eva) Blue of Fresno, seven grandchildren and five great-grandchildren.

Funeral services will be held Jan. 9 at 10 a.m. from the F. Arthur Cortner Chapel, Redlands Lodge No. 300, F. and A.M., officiating. Interment will be in Hillside Memorial Park.
